Output fe7828e13c10776862a706397594a3b93a67ef3d1f64ce2d9b05b6fa992e5a58:0

value
997440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 840d68b4d7e0898f0d972593ef0255b88270b575 OP_EQUAL
address
3DjFBYFjXKnEU21psBF4rMKgpXj98rGVpw
transaction
fe7828e13c10776862a706397594a3b93a67ef3d1f64ce2d9b05b6fa992e5a58
confirmations
325380
spent
true